Effective Arthritis Pain Relief for Hands, fingers, and wrist: This microwavable heat hand muff works by increasing blood circulation and flexibility of your joints to decrease pain. When you apply heat to painful hands, it relaxes tendons and ligaments. Perfect for relieving hand arthritis, carpal tunnel syndrome, trigger finger and cold hands.
Easy to Use: Microwave for 1 minutes to get a soothing moist heat which better results in alleviating hand and wrist pain like joint pain, stiff muscles, soreness. Size: 7″ X 11.2″, big enough to fit most, warms your entire hand and up to wrist.
Natural Heat Therapy with Moist Heat – Filled with Flaxseeds, Millets, retains moist heat longer for extra relaxation. Heat therapy helps to relax sore muscles and improve flexibility and range of motion. Perfect for manicures, hand massages, warming cold hands, or relieving joint pain and tension.
Removable Soft Minky Cover: The hand therapy gloves cover is made of soft skin-friendly minky, washable and durable enough to stand up to frequent use. The weight of the filler packs will put gentle pressure on the target area, and help relieve the hand discomfort.
